”If you play the role of combo, cancel attack, attacker / defender / healer during battle, "chain gauge" will gradually accumulate. Whenever the gauge is full, you can activate the powerful special move "Chain Attack" in collaboration with party members during battle!”
“The chain attack will proceed while selecting each character in the party. First of all, the strategy (order) will be presented by three friends. After deciding which order to go with, select the companion who will carry out that order, then select the arts and decide the attack brilliantly!”
”During the chain attack, orders for Uroboros may come out. If you can accomplish it, you will be able to visit even more powerful techniques than the orders from your friends! I want you to try various ways to see how this order comes out.”
“Tactical points (TP) are also important for chain attacks. If you select a friend, the TP will be added up, and if you exceed "100% (points)", the order will be fulfilled and a powerful blow "Chain Arts" will be activated. The order has a reputation, and the higher the percentage, the better the cooperation!”
